
ThunderBolts Drop Second Straight to Schaumburg
August 19, 2023 - Frontier League (FL)
Windy City ThunderBolts News Release
CRESTWOOD, IL - The Schaumburg Boomers scored five unanswered runs to erase an early ThunderBolts lead and capture game two of the series 5-1 at Ozinga Field Saturday night.
The Bolts (34-48) took advantage of Schaumburg starter Antonio Frias's control problems early. Frias walked the bases loaded but pitched out of the jam. In the second inning, he walked the leadoff batter but couldn't escape unscathed. Dan Robinson stole second base and scored on a Paul Coumoulos single.
Garrett Christman mowed down the Schaumburg batting order through the first five innings, facing just one batter over the minimum but the Boomers (49-33) got to him in the sixth. They put their first two runners on thanks to a hit and an error. The second error of the inning allowed two runs to score and put Schaumburg on top for good. Gaige Howard's RBI double made it 3-1.
The Boomers posted two more runs the next inning on a Will Prater RBI single and a Travis Holt sacrifice fly.
After their early run, the ThunderBolts struggled on offense. They finished the game with four hits, all singles, and didn't put another man past second base.
Frias (3-1) allowed only one run (zero earned) on two hits over six innings. He walked five but struck out 13. Christman (7-4) allowed five runs (four earned) in 6.1 innings with two strikeouts and a walk and took the loss.
